Brenden Aaronson has been excellent this season for Red Bull Salzburg. The 20-year-old has scored three goals and three assists in 14 games for the Serienmeister and, as a result, has been linked with a transfer away from the club—Bundesliga side RB Leipzig are a logical destination but the Germans face competition in Serie A club MilanTransfermarkt has learned through multiple sources that in D.C. United talent Kevin Paredes Salzburg have already identified a replacement. 

Paredes has been part of the latest wave of young talented Major League Soccer players. The midfielder, who has mostly operated on the left this season for the Washington-based club, has featured in 20 games across all competitions and scored two goals and two assists. Not a one-to-one replacement for Aaronson, Paredes has played a different role for D.C. United this season.

Salzburg want Paredes – Versatility key for potential transfer?

Salzburg like Paredes’ versatility and believe that the player can grow into multiple roles once he makes the move to Austria. Whether that is in a more defensive role or at the center of the park where he can create more one-v-one situations remains to be seen. Either way, Salzburg are intrigued. Whether a transfer can be completed remains to be seen, Paredes’ market value is currently $1.1 million, but the 18-year-old is on an upward trajectory. Signed to a homegrown contract and, according to SpotracParedes earns $100,000, he is ranked among the most valuable Americans born in 2003.
